I purchased three of the new T-Link 3's and would like to use a USB battery of mine as a backup. I bought a male-to-female USB cable and connected it to the USB connector where the battery usually goes. When I plug in my battery and power on the T-Link 3, the battery shuts off after about a minute. If I use the USB battery supplied with the T3, all works fine.

Am I doing something wrong? Seems pretty simple to me but it does not work with my battery.

Not all USB battery packs are created equal. There are many batteries available on the market but they are designed to charge a smartphone or tablet at around 1 amp charge rate. Not all batteries can handle the much smaller current demands of the T-Link 3 or an emitter.

Your battery thinks it is charging a smartphone and when the smartphone is fully charged, the charge rate goes way down. The low power draw of the T3 or emitter looks, to the battery, as the smartphone is fully charged and automatically shuts off to avoid overcharging the smartphone. The USB Battery RaceAmerica provides with the T-Link 3 is designed to function at the small power draw level and therefore does not get fooled and shut off.

Not too much you can do other than use the supplied USB Battery. A single 8-hour charge will last for almost 60 hours of use.

I bought one of the smart batteries and thought it was smart enough to adjust to all power conditions. I actually tried three different USB batteries, two of them I had laying around and a few years old. The smart battery stays on for almost 2 minutes but still shuts off. The older batteries stay awake for as little as 30 seconds.

Is there a smart battery you could recommend that truely is smart?

PatCray wrote:Is there a smart battery you could recommend that truely is smart?

Most smart batteries have the ability to negotiate with a smartphone for the charge level and the charge voltage. This allows for faster charging due to higher charge voltages and currents. This is the opposite direction a T-Link 3 needs for low power draw. Of the dozen or so brands of battery manufacturers RaceAmerica investigated, we found a limited few that could operate at low power draws and even fewer with consistent operation and quality. RaceAmerica tested many batteries extensively and selected the best fit for low power draw and consistent operation.
